Analysis

In 2023, waste — emissions (co2eq) from ch4 in British Virgin Islands stood at 3.75 kt. That is the highest value across all 63 years on record.

Compared with earlier readings it is up 0.8% on the previous year and up 12.6% over ten years.

Over the whole period, waste — emissions (co2eq) from ch4 in British Virgin Islands peaked at 3.75 kt in 2023 and was at its lowest, 0.5656 kt, in 1969.

British Virgin Islands ranks 191st of 201 countries on this measure, in the bottom quarter.

The series is highly variable year to year, so single readings are best treated with caution.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
